We offer year-round water taxi service to the islands of Casco Bay, Portland, Maine. All taxis are reservation based, and we do accept same-day reservations which can be made by phone.
A map of our destinations can be found below. Not sure where to travel? Check out our trip ideas page for inspiration.
Use the fare calculator below to estimate the cost of your trip. All fares are one-way flat rates for up to six people; we reserve the right to add other parties to your boat.
